The KL250G comes with pretty bad suspension, like all bikes below a certain price point. A cult bike in North America now. Not expensive yet, and worth spending on to make things right. The MZ366 with a spring calibrated to match my rider weight does what the guy at Works Performance told me would happen on my SRX6, back in the day. With a good shock, you sort of stop noticing the shock and concentrate on the ride. MZ366 does this for the Super Sherpa. The YSS makes nicely made shocks. I wish mine had more features but they wont fit in the space provided by Chuo and Minato engineers, so the MZ366 is what it is. Among its many virtues, you do not need a tool to change the spring. The YSS staff in the video showing how to change spring are people I would like to meet. I am delighted to make this huge improvement to my SS.Webike deserves a special mention for making the purchase possible, and catering to so many good bikes with good stuff. They have a good site and the shipping to USA is good. Price wise, there is no real alternative for me. The OEM shock can be rebuilt, and generic hydraulic washers and nitrogen are available, maybe a spring found, but YSS off the shelf is worth the investment. View Detail

?attachment The CBR650R is mounted at the same position angle as the NORMAL. However, when the handlebar was cut to the Left lock, it interfered with the interior cover next to the Meter, so the interior cover was cut away. I also purchased a 45° angled banjo adapter for the mesh hose to accommodate the tension of the mesh hose. ・NORMAL (Reserve integrated horizontal master) Impressions of No complaints on public roads. Familiar feel and very easy to handle. However, when the brake is set to "hard brake," the rate of increase in braking force relative to the input seems to decrease, and the brake becomes more forceful. Radipon (Reserve separate body portrait master) Impressions of It was totally different from what I expected, my expectation was that it would feel like a Rear brake… It is really a mild and easy-to-handle radipon. On public roads, it feels like NORMAL! I wonder if it's because NORMAL is the same NISSIN? But I felt the radipon effect from Breaking a little stronger, and It can be hung up to a hard brake without effort. I felt trust that this could stop.View Detail
